首页 > TAG信息列表 > onblur

WEB前端初学者笔记(16)--表单事件

一、表单事件 1.常用事件 在JavaScript中,常用的表单事件有3种。 (1)onfocus和onblur (2)onselect (3)onchange 2.onfocus和onblur onfocus表示获取焦点时触发的事件,而onblur表示失去焦点时触发的事件,两者是相反操作。 onfocus和onblur这两个事件往往都是配合一起使用的。例如用户准备

页面优化之监听页面隐藏/显示

有些时候我们需要在项目中判断用户是否在浏览当前页面,或者当前页面是否处于激活状态。然后再进行相关的操作。浏览器中可通过window对象的onblur、onfocus判断,或者document的hidden属性判断。 1、window.onblur & window.onfocus关于是否失焦点,浏览器对象有onfocus 和 onblur事件

input中placeholder属性

注意:IE 9及更早的版本不支持该属性 //列表框输入前默认灰色字体,输内容时字体加黑 <input type="text" name="" id="user_name" placeholder="用户名/学号/手机号"> 可以使用js中的焦点事件完成该功能 1.onfocus获得焦点 2.onblur失去焦点 <script> var text = document

页面优化之监听页面隐藏/显示

js 怎样判断用户是否在浏览当前页面   有些时候我们需要在项目中判断用户是否在浏览当前页面,或者当前页面是否处于激活状态。然后再进行相关的操作。浏览器中可通过window对象的onblur、onfocus判断,或者document的hidden属性判断。 1、window.onblur & window.onfocus 关于是

20201126千锤百炼软工人

onblur事件也是html标签的一个事件其中这个时间是当鼠标焦点移动到文本框后用户开始输入当焦点离开文本框后此时进行js验证这个事件对我当下的一个程序前端的设计是一个十分好用的一个功能

js——2表单检验,onfocus,onblur,onkeyup用法

1onfocus,onblur,onkeyup用法介绍 2案例1一简单表单校验 3案例2一简单页面校验 1用法介绍 onblur:事件会在对象失去焦点时发生 onfocus:是onblur 相反事件 。 onkeyup: 表示键盘每输完一个字符之后触发,就是键盘上的按键被放开时。 案例: <input type="text" id="username" onblur="chec

学习进度

 那天通过观看老师发的教学视频来学习了对表单的校验,并把提示显示在文本框右侧。必填项给出标识,格式错误给出红色字体的提示,格式正确后消除字体提示。 在需要添加提示信息的文本框后面加一个span标签,并设好id。在该文本框的input标签内写入一个onfocus()函数和一个onblur()函数,再建立

Javascript文本字段值重点

环境: 请使用IE进行测试 需求:我有一条警报消息,该消息检查用户是否输入了小于8位的值-用户将无法移至下一个字段….他应保持在同一字段上. 问题:除了一项功能外,其他所有功能都可以正常使用-当用户在文本字段中输入小于8位的任何值时,他的焦点将以光标移至所输入值的第一个字母的方式

javascript-如何在IE8中禁用body.blur()?

我致力于在IE8中运行的企业Web应用程序.似乎在主体上调用了blur()导致IE窗口发送到后台.不幸的是,此代码位于供应商控制的应用程序的一部分中. 有没有什么可能的方式可以防止在不修改实际调用body.blur()的代码的情况下在主体上调用blur()? 由于这是企业应用程序,因此可以接受应用程

javascript-如何检测鼠标悬停触发的模糊?

我正在监听表单输入上的模糊事件.现在,当在控件外部按下鼠标时,事件立即被触发.我需要能够检测何时在输入之外完全单击了鼠标(先按下鼠标,然后再按下鼠标). 我已经可以使用可以处理的事件类型了吗?如果没有,处理此类事件的最佳方法是什么?解决方法:我会说不,没有任何类型的事件.而且

javascript – blur event.relatedTarget返回null

我有一个< input type =“text”>字段,当这个字段失去焦点时我需要清除它(这意味着用户点击了页面上的某个地方).但有一个例外.当用户单击特定元素时,不应清除输入文本字段. 我尝试使用event.relatedTarget来检测用户是否点击了某个地方而不是我的特定< div>. 但是正如您在下面的代

javascript – 如果任何一个子节点获得焦点,则阻止触发模糊事件

我在页面上有一个div,显示有关特定类别(图像,名称等)的一些信息. 当我点击编辑图像时,它会将类别置于编辑模式,这样我就可以更新名称.从下图中可以看出,它显示“Soup”当前处于编辑模式,其他处于正常视图模式.这一切都按预期工作,取消/保存按钮做正确的事情. (我尝试添加图像,但不

javascript – Onblur事件在另一个div的onclick之前触发

如上所述,我有一个按钮,单击该按钮将打开子菜单.对于子菜单中的每个选项,有三个元素(实际上我想的更多,但为了简单起见,它将保持为3).我将焦点放在子菜单的主div(白色’框架’)上.这个div的Onblur – 然后我隐藏了子菜单. 这一切都按预期运行 – 但我有一个探测器,当单击特定选项

javascript – 关于BLUR没有开火

最近从编写小型vb应用程序转变为Web应用程序.此时尚未切换到C#. 尝试获取ASP.net表单以添加几个文本框并在另一个文本框中显示结果. 这是启用和ASP.NET 4.0表单在插入模式下使用FormView控件. 问题在于,无论我是否在框中单击,Tab键进入框中或出来它似乎都不会触发JavaScript <scri

用Javascript更改元素的onfocus处理程序?

我有一个表单,其默认值描述了应该进入该字段的内容(替换标签).当用户聚焦字段时,会调用此函数: function clear_input(element) { element.value = ""; element.onfocus = null; } onfocus设置为null,这样如果用户在字段中放入某些内容并决定更改它,则不会删除它们的输入(

Javascript新手 – 似乎onBlur的一个元素“覆盖”另一个元素的onclick

我有两个要素: <input type="text" name="pmTo" id="pmTo" onkeyup="offerSuggs('none');" onfocus="showSelect();" onblur="hideSelect();" /> 和一个动态创建的(这是自动建议程序的所有部分): $suggString .= '&

javascript – 事件冒泡和onblur事件

我正在编写一个表单验证脚本,并希望在其onblur事件触发时验证给定字段.我还想使用事件冒泡,所以我不必将onblur事件附加到每个单独的表单字段.不幸的是,onblur事件并没有泡沫.只是想知道是否有人知道可以产生相同效果的优雅解决方案.解决方法:ppk有一种技术,包括IE:http://www.quirk

javascript – 如何在IE中使用relatedTarget(或等效)?

显然IE(11)与relatedTarget存在问题,例如模糊事件. IE有替代方法来获取relatedTarget吗? 这是一个在IE中产生错误的示例: https://jsfiddle.net/rnyqy78m/解决方法:如果我查看此列表:https://developer.mozilla.org/en-US/docs/Web/API/MouseEvent/relatedTarget模糊不包含在标准辅助

javascript – 什么触发移动游猎(iPad)上的模糊事件

我有一个datepicker控制器,当用户触摸屏幕上不是datepicker的某个地方时,我想模糊.我遇到的问题是我不明白触发模糊事件的原因.例如,如果用户触摸下个月触发模糊事件,那么我想说,如果relatedTarget是datepicker(下个月)内的一个类,那么显示下个月并且不隐藏datepicker,如果relatedT

javascript – onBlur()无法正常工作

我想要< div>如果他们点击元素区域,则关闭.shell-pop类.它似乎不会触发,也没有任何日志或警报消失.我环顾四周,一切都正常吗? jQuery的 $('document').ready(function () { updateCart(); $(".shell").click(function (e) { e.preventDefault(); $(".shel

搜索框获取转移焦点事件

搜索框实例 <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<title>Title</title> </head> <body> 搜索框<input type="text" value="618大促" id = 'i1

HTML事件

窗口事件属性 onload加载完成 onunload 卸载完成 <body "console.log('加载完成') " "console.log('卸载完成')"> </body> onfocus 聚焦 onblur失焦 <body "console.log('聚焦')" "console.log('失焦')"&g